Occurrence of Geothermal Energy Temperature increases with depth within the Earth at an average of about 25ºC/km. So if the average surface temperature is 20ºC, the temperature at 3 km is only 95ºC. Hydrogen has a low energy density. While the energy per mass of hydrogen is substantially greater than most other fuels, as can be seen in Figure 1, its energy by volume is much less than liquid fuels like gasoline.
